运行中主变跳闸原因分析与处理

摘    要:以吕梁供电分公司为例,指出老旧110kV变电站在综自改造后不久,1号、2号主变先后在正常运行中三侧断路器同时跳闸,无保护动作信号,经过对主变保护和二次回路做详细检查分析,阐明可能引起跳闸的若干薄弱环节。

关 键 词:变压器  跳闸  非电量保护

Causes Analysis and Measures of Main Transformer Tripping in Operation

Abstract:Takes Lvliang Power Supply Company as an example,No.1 and No.2 main transformers three sides of circuit breakers tripping at the same time,and no protective action signal after the comprehensive reconstruction of the old 110 kV substation.Based on the specific check of main transformer protection and the secondary circuit,causes of main transformer tripping are analyzed.
Keywords:transformer  tripping  non-quantity of electricity protection
